Step-by-Step Renovation Process
Assessment: A thorough evaluation of the sash window's condition to determine locations needing repair, from rot and draughts to damaged glass.
Elimination: Carefully eliminating any degrading components, consisting of withered sash cords, old paint, and harmed glass.
Repair: Fixing any damaged lumber and ensuring all parts are structurally sound. This might include changing areas of wood, especially if rot is present.
Re-glazing: Adding new or restored glass to guarantee insulation and minimize draughts.
Painting and Finishing: Applying a protective and visually pleasing surface to enhance the sturdiness and look of the window.
Sash Cord Replacement: Installing new sash cords to ensure smooth operation of the window's opening and closing.
Last Inspection: A thorough check to ensure all elements function well which finishes are consistent and constant.

ConsiderationImportanceSelecting a Skilled ProfessionalGuarantee that the renovation team has experience and competence in sash window work.Historical RegulationsLook for local preservation orders or policies that affect your renovation plans.Product SelectionUse premium materials that match the duration design and appropriate for durability.Budget plan PlanningFigure out a realistic budget plan that includes all elements of the renovation procedure.Cost of Sash Window RenovationThe cost of sash window renovation can vary based on several elements, including the degree of the damage, products utilized, and the geographic area of the property. Below is a rough estimate for typical sash window renovation services:
ServiceApproximated CostComplete Assessment₤ 50 - ₤ 100Timber Repair₤ 150 - ₤ 400Glass Replacement₤ 100 - ₤ 300Re-glazing₤ 80 - ₤ 200 per paneSash Cord Replacement₤ 50 - ₤ 150 per windowComplete Renovation₤ 400 - ₤ 1,200 per windowKeep in mind: Prices are a sign and may differ based upon particular conditions and requirements.
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)1. How long does sash window renovation take?
The period can differ depending upon the extent of the work required. A basic repair may take a couple of hours, while a full renovation can take numerous days to a couple of weeks.
2. Can I remodel my sash windows myself?
While small repairs might be manageable for convenient people, complete renovation is typically best delegated professionals who have actually the needed skills, tools, and understanding.
3. Will refurbishing my sash windows improve energy performance?
Yes, a well-executed renovation, consisting of addressing draughts and updating to double-glazing where possible, can considerably boost energy effectiveness.
4. How often should sash windows be preserved?
Routine inspections every couple of years help catch minor problems before they end up being major problems. A full renovation ought to be thought about around every 20-25 years depending on wear and tear.
5. What materials are used in sash window renovation?
Normally, high-quality wood is used, but options for modern-day materials like composite or uPVC are also readily available, depending on client preference and policies.
